    The Carey is a core PJD Guitars model, a single-cutaway electric hand-built in York, England by luthier Leigh Dovey. It has a flat-top single-cut body and is often fitted with a humbucker/P-90 pairing, offered in Standard, Elite and Limited editions.

    The Severn is the flagship of Knaggs Guitars' Chesapeake Series, a double-cutaway solid-body electric guitar with a flat body, a set rock-maple neck, a 25.5-inch scale, and 22 frets. It is offered in a wide range of pickup layouts (including SSS, T-style, HSH, HH, P90 and Firebird) with Knaggs Chesapeake hardtail or tremolo bridges.

    The Friedman Vintage-T is a single-cutaway, T-style solidbody electric guitar built in the USA by Dave Friedman with luthier Grover Jackson. The reviewed model pairs a mahogany body and a bolt-on maple neck with a pau ferro fingerboard and a set of Friedman Classic 90 (P-90 style) pickups over a fixed hardtail bridge. Thin aged nitrocellulose lacquer, a 10-to-14-inch compound-radius board, and Plek-finished fretwork give it vintage looks with modern playability.

    The Heartbreaker is a Macmull Custom Guitars single-cutaway electric with a bound one-piece alder body, bolt-on hard maple neck and Madagascar rosewood 9.5-inch radius fingerboard with 21 Dunlop 6105 frets. The Heartbreaker Custom variant is fitted with two of Macmull's matched RVT P-90 pickups.
